      Customer question: How do you download program to CoDrone? Do you use USB do download it directly to the drone or do you wirelessly download the code?

      1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
      • robolink_wes
        robolink_wes last edited by

        So the CoDrone itself isn't where code downloads to, it's simply receiving commands. If you're programming in Snap, you're actually sending live commands to the drone as you run the program. If you're programming in Arduino, you're downloading the code to the Smart Inventor board (which is our custom Arduino), which communicates your code to the CoDrone via Bluetooth (BLE). The code is downloaded to the board via a USB cable.
